body {
	font-family: Verdana, Arial, Tahoma;
	font-size:11px;
	color: #000000;
	background-color: #919294;
	background-image: url(images/betaalbarekeukens_body.png);
	background-position: 0 0;
	background-repeat:repeat-y;
}

#linkermenuachtergrond {
	border-collapse:collapse;
	border-top:15px solid #EFEFEF;
	border-left:10px solid #EFEFEF;
}

td#linkermenuachtergrond{
	background:#FDB927;
}

strong{
	color: #000000;
}

#maintable{
	background: #EFEFEF;
	border-right:3px solid #FFFFFF;
}

td {
	font-size:11px;
}

.admin_table_td {
	border-bottom:1px solid #CCCCCC;
	border-top:1px solid #CCCCCC;
}

p {
	font-size: 11px;
	margin:0px;
}

ul{
	font-size: 11px;
}

li{
	font-size: 11px;
}

a{
	color: #000000;
	text-decoration: underline;
}

a:hover{
	color: #000000;
	text-decoration: none;
}

input {
	font-size:11px;
}
select {
	font-size:11px;
}
.topmenu_off {
	color:#bfc5c5; 
	text-decoration:none;
}
.topmenu_on {
	color: #bfc5c5;
	text-decoration:underline;
}
.menu_button_off {
	background: transparent;
	width:140px;
	height:23px;
	padding-left:5px;
	font-size:10px;
	font-weight: bold;
	color:#000000;
	cursor:pointer;
}
.menu_button_on {
	background: transparent;
	width:140px;
	height:23px;
	padding-left:5px;
	font-size:10px;
	font-weight: bold;
	color:#0078af;
	cursor:pointer;
}
.beheer_button_off {
	background: #EFAD21;
	width:140px;
	height:23px;
	padding-left:5px;
	font-size:10px;
	font-weight: bold;
	color:#ffffff;
	cursor:pointer;
}

.beheer_button_on {
	background: #EFAD21;
	width:140px;
	height:23px;
	padding-left:5px;
	font-size:10px;
	font-weight: bold;
	color:#789792;
	cursor:pointer;
}

.contenttable{ 		
	border-spacing: 0px;	 
	table-layout: fixed;
}

.hometable{
	margin:10px;
	background-color:#646464;
	border:1px solid #000000;	
}

.hometable tr td{
	padding:5px;
}

.hometable tr td a{
	color:#FFFFFF;
	text-decoration:none;
}

.tableheader_orange {	
	background-color: #505050;
	color:#fdb927;	
	font-size:11px;
	line-height:20px;
	font-weight: bold;
	font-family: "Trebuchet MS", Verdana, Arial, Tahoma;
}

.tableheader_orange td {
	line-height:20px;
}


.tdbottomline {	
		border-bottom:1px solid #FE8746;		
}

.tdgreybottomline {	
		background-color: #F5F6F9;
		border-bottom:1px solid #FE8746;
}

.selectbox {
	width: 130px;	
}

#toplogodiv {
	width:740px;
	height:100px;
	left: 10px;
	top: 50px;
	position:absolute;
	border-bottom:3px solid #FFFFFF;
	background-image: url(images/betaalbarekeukens_header.jpg);
}

#bannerdiv{	
	display: block;
}

#timedisplay{
	display: block;
}

#linkermenuachtergrond{
	background-color: #fbfbfb;
}

#welcomedisplay{
	display: block;
}

#topmenu{	
	display: block;
}

#productgrouptable{
	display: block;
}

#categoryfiltertable{
	border: 1px solid #000000;
	background-color: #646464;
}

#categoryfiltertable tr td{
	color:#FFFFFF;
	font-weight:bold;
}

#categorytable td{
	font-size: 11px;
}

.categorytableheader{	
	background-color: #FDB927;
	font-size:12px;
	font-weight: bold;
	color:#000000;
	font-family: Verdana, Arial, Tahoma;
	border-top:1px solid #000000;		
	border-bottom:1px solid #000000;		
}

.categorytablerowwhite{
	background-color: #FFFFFF;	
}

.categorytabletdbottomline{
	padding: 3px;
	border-bottom:1px solid #000000;	
}

.categorytablerowgrey{
	background-color: #F4F6F9;		
}

.categoryredstrikethroughtext{
	font-weight:bold;
	font-size:11px;
	color:#FF0000;
	text-decoration:line-through;
}

.categorygreypricetext{
	font-weight:bold;
	font-size:11px;
	color:#808080;	
}

.categorylightgreytext{	
	color:#BBBBBB;	
	display: inline;
}

.categorygreentext{
	font-weight:bold;
	font-size:11px;
	color:#00BB00;	
}

.categoryorangetext{
	font-weight:bold;
	font-size:11px;
	color:#FF8000;	
}

#showproducttable {
	background-color: #FFFFFF;	
	border-spacing: 0px;	 
	padding:0px;
}

.productinfoheadertd {
	font-size:11px;
	font-weight: bold;
	font-family: Verdana, Arial, Tahoma;
	font-weight:bold;	
}

#vergrotentext{
	color:#3e504d;
}

#productinfomaintd{
	background-color:#FFFFFF; 
	padding:5px;
}

#productinfosoldmessage{
	font-size:16px;
	font-weight:bold;
	color:#4C6C8D;
}

#productinfoname_id{
	font-size:18px;
	font-weight: bold;
	font-family: Verdana, Arial, Tahoma;
	text-decoration:none;
}

.productinforightcolumn {
	 color:#000;
	 font-weight:normal;
}

#productinfovantext {
	color:#FF0000;	
	text-align:center;	
}

#productinfovanprice {
	color:#FF0000;		
	font-weight:bold;
	color:#FF0000;
	font-size:16px;
	display:inline;
	text-decoration:line-through;
}

#productinfovoortext {
	color:#808080;
}

#productinfovoorprice {
	font-weight:bold;
	color:#0078af;
	font-size:16px;
	display:inline;
	text-decoration:underline;		
}

#meerwetentable{
	border-top:1px solid #505050;
	border-bottom:1px solid #505050;	
}

#meerwetentablediv{
	font-size:10px;
	text-align:center;
	color:#808080;
	margin:10px;
	display:block;:
}

#makebidttable {
	border-bottom:1px solid #FE8746;
}


#makebiddiv{
	font-size:10px;
	text-align:center;
	color:#808080;
	margin:10px;
	display:block;	
}


#biddertd{
	font-size:10px;
	color:#808080;
}

#alleadvertentiestd{
 	font-size:10px;
 	color:#808080;
}

#alleadvertentieslink{
	font-weight:bold; 
	text-decoration:underline; 
}

#productinfobottomtable{
	border-top:1px solid #505050;
	border-bottom:1px solid #505050;
}

#mailafriendlink{
	color:#808080;
	font-size:10px;	
}

#requestinfotable{
	background-color:#FFFFFF;	
}

#requestinfotabletd{
	background-color:#FFFFFF;	
}

.inputfield {
	font-size:11px;	
}
	
.inputbox {
	border:1px solid #789792;
}

.radio_choice {
	font-size:9px;
	font-style:italic;
	color:#666666;
}

#reserverenproductoranjekolom {
	background-color:#FE8746;	
}
.categoryimageborderstyle {
		border:1px solid #FFFFFF;
} 
.populairproductsimageborder {
		border:1px solid #FFFFFF;
}

.kop_uksz {
	height:39px;
	overflow:hidden;
	width:574px;
	background-color: #FDB927;
	font-size:12px;
	font-weight: bold;
	color:#000000;
}

.kop_uksz h1 {
	padding:10px 0 0 0;
	font-weight:normal;
	margin:0;
	font-family:verdana;
	color:#FFFFFF;
	text-indent:10px;
	font-size:18px;
	line-height:20px;
}

#referedshowcategorymainbackground {
	background-color:#FFFFFF;
}




#productgrouptable{
	display: block;
}

/* constructor */
#maintable #linkermenuachtergrond{vertical-align:top;text-align:left;padding:0;margin:0}
#linkermenuachtergrond #categorynavigation{position:relative;display:block;padding:5px 0 0 0;margin:0;width:140px;overflow:hidden}
#linkermenuachtergrond #categorynavigation ul{position:relative;display:block;clear:both;list-style:none;background:transparent;padding:0;margin:0}
#linkermenuachtergrond #categorynavigation ul li{border:none;position:relative;float:left;clear:both;list-style:none;background:transparent;padding:0;margin:0 5px 5px 5px;line-height:normal;height:auto;letter-spacing:0px;text-align:left}
#linkermenuachtergrond #categorynavigation ul li a{border:none;display:block;float:left;clear:both;height:auto;background:transparent;margin:0;cursor:pointer;line-height:normal;text-decoration:none;text-align:left}
/* ie6 */
* html #linkermenuachtergrond #categorynavigation ul{height:1%;margin-left:-5px;list-style:none}
* html #linkermenuachtergrond #categorynavigation ul li a{width:130px}

/* specific styles */
/* ============ */
/* specific link style */
#linkermenuachtergrond #categorynavigation ul li a{width:118px;font-weight:bold;padding:5px;font-size:10px;letter-spacing:0px;color:#000000}
/* specific menu button style */
#linkermenuachtergrond #categorynavigation ul li.menu_button_off  a{background:transparent;color:#000000}
#linkermenuachtergrond #categorynavigation ul li.menu_button_off  a:hover{background:transparent;color:#0078af}
/* specific beheer button style */
#linkermenuachtergrond #categorynavigation ul li.beheer_button_off a {background:#EFAD21;color:#ffffff}
#linkermenuachtergrond #categorynavigation ul li.beheer_button_off a:hover {background:#EFAD21;color:#789792}
